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’s) For Carbonator
What is the primary role of a Carbonator?
The primary role of a Carbonator is to operate and maintain carbonation systems used in the beverage industry. This involves ensuring optimal levels of carbonation in beverages, monitoring and maintaining pressure relief systems, cleaning and sanitizing carbonation system components, troubleshooting and resolving carbonation system issues, and following established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s).

What are the career prospects for a Carbonator?
Carbonators can advance their careers by developing specialized skills in areas such as carbonation system design and optimization, process engineering, or quality control. With experience and additional training, Carbonators can also move into management positions such as Production Supervisor or Plant Manager.
What are the typical working conditions for a Carbonator?
Carbonators typically work in production facilities and may be exposed to noise, dust, and hazardous chemicals. They may also be required to work in cold and wet environments. Proper personal protective equipment (PPE) is essential to ensure safety in these conditions.
